WATCH: Moment teen is chased down after stealing from busker
A busker has stopped a would be thief from stealing his earnings for the day and he managed to capture it all on camera.
Guitarist Martin Campos was live streaming his set on Facebook in the middle of busy Pitt Street Mall in Sydney CBD on Saturday afternoon, when a teenager allegedly grabbed his basket of money and made a run for it.
Mr Campos didn’t hesitate to drop everything and chase down the alleged thief, pinning him to the ground and taking back the cash.
“The guy grabbed my case full of notes so I ran after him and luckily, others had seen what happened and managed to catch him,” Mr Campos told Daily Mail Australia.
“At first I was angry but afterwards, I just felt sorry for the guy,” he said.
Mr Campos and witnesses managed to detain the man until police arrived on the seen, shortly before 6pm.
Despite almost losing his day’s earnings, Mr Campos said he wasn’t holding a grudge.
“At first I was angry but afterwards, I just felt sorry for the guy,” he said.
Police arrested the 18-year-old man from Hillsdale on Saturday, he will face Parramatta court on Sunday.
